The Fundamental Role of a Cable Connector Gland

At its core, a cable gland serves several vital functions. Its primary purpose is to attach and secure the end of a cable to a piece of equipment, panel, or enclosure. This creates a powerful strain-relief system, preventing the cable from being pulled out of the terminal and protecting the internal wiring from tension and damage. Navigating the World of Cable Gland Types

When specifying a component for a project, it’s important to understand the different cable gland types available. The choice depends heavily on the type of cable being used, the material of the enclosure, and the environment. Glands are broadly categorized for use with either armored or unarmored cables. Armored cables have an additional layer of metal protection and require a gland that can clamp onto this armor to provide electrical continuity and grounding. Unarmored cables are more common in general applications and require a gland that focuses purely on sealing and strain relief. Materials also vary, from brass and stainless steel for highly corrosive or hazardous areas to advanced thermoplastics, which offer excellent durability, corrosion resistance, and a stylish finish for modern applications. A Step-by-Step Guide to Cable Gland Installation

Flawless cable gland installation is critical to harnessing the full protective capabilities of the device. The process, while straightforward, requires attention to detail. First, prepare by ensuring the cable’s outer diameter is within the specified range for the gland and that the mounting hole in the enclosure is cleanly cut to the correct size. Next, disassemble the gland and slide the sealing nut and the main body over the cable. Insert the gland body into the mounting hole and secure it from the inside of the enclosure using the provided locknut. Once the gland body is firmly in place, push the cable through to the desired length. Finally, tighten the sealing nut. As you tighten, the internal rubber seal compresses evenly around the cable’s outer jacket, creating the robust, IP68-rated seal.
